Our school serves children from preschool age (three years old) through grade four. Our philosophy and methodology are rooted in constructivist theory, project based learning and an integrated approach to curricular development. CIS’ innovative approach to educational programming offers teachers the opportunity to be deeply involved in designing curriculum for and with children.

NOW HIRING: Primary Lead Teacher
Community Independent School (CIS) is seeking a dynamic and dedicated person for the position of lead teacher in the primary grades. CIS is based on a constructivist model, meaning that our teachers both lead and follow, offering developmentally appropriate curriculum to our students while also encouraging children to follow their own interests within a supportive classroom environment. The lead teacher is responsible for all subject areas and is supported by resource teachers in the areas of Spanish, art, music and science.
